    When to buy male retic for breeding?
    I'm anticipating my two females going around fall of 2020 to early 2021. So when should I buy my male? I know what I want and who produces them it's just a question of when I need to pull the trigger and buy?

    I would be looking at hatchlings now, though you could buy between now and next spring if you're getting a hatchling.

    Also don't discount finding an older male close to you so you could pick it up, especially if there are others close to you who keep retics. He'd cost a little more to purchase but you wouldn't have to pay shipping.
